About The Position

Steampunk is seeking a creative and hands-on Project Manager who is an expert in delivering innovative technology solutions. This role involves team leadership for the complete life cycle of solution development and delivery, providing Agile Project Management and Scrum Master support for Agile teams. The Project Manager will coordinate with product owners and stakeholders on backlog prioritization, create release schedules and roadmaps, and establish technical practices and release management standards aligned with customer processes. The individual will ensure the team effectively follows Agile scrum processes and drives high client satisfaction. In this government client consulting environment, the Project Manager will lead project tasking and delivery, acting as a client liaison, team coach, and mentor.
